I'm at 244rwhp/281ftlbs trq after pi swap, pullies, cai, h pipe, flow 40's, and chip (dyno tuned). I do have a **** trans, and an auto, but I gained approx 64rwhp with all of these items. After the tranny swap, TB/Plenum will be next I think.

im probably putting down around 265ish hp at the wheels with my mods. It ran a 13.5@101 at maple grove raceway a few weeks ago which is a whole second of my old ET and i had 209 at the wheels before the swap.

Ken Bjones stil holds the record at 368 rwhp N/A. using PI heads. there's only so far you can go n/a, and the pi heads work well enough so that no one's developed a new casting for them yet.but the plenum and tb work great on blower cars unless you ditch the pi manifold. that's why i like them. it's one of those bolt ons that compliments other mods.
